A sweeping, suspenseful story of two women bound together by the devastating faultlines of a past tragedy, Past Participle is a study of love and guilt, power and desire, retribution and forgiveness, asking, what price a life?

Dakar, Senegal, 1987: On a rainy night after a wild party, the British ambassador's wife, Vivienne Hughes, is involved in a car crash. Her vehicle hits the motor-bike of a young Senegalese doc-tor, Aime Tunkara, killing him. Pleading diplomatic immunity, Vivienne and her husband flee to England. Three decades later, Aime's little sister, Lily Tunkara, now a high-flying lawyer in Dakar, finds a photograph that compels her to investigate what really happened that rainy night. As Lily faces in-creasing hostility from the local community, she turns to Vivienne Hughes, the only remaining wit-ness, but is either woman pre-pared for the truth to emerge?
